Retaspimycin, also known as IPI-504, Infinity’s lead product candidate, is a small molecule inhibitor of heat shock protein 90 (Hsp90). We believe that the inhibition of Hsp90 has broad therapeutic potential for patients with solid and hematological tumors, including cancers that are resistant to other drugs, and that retaspimycin has the potential to be a best-in-class Hsp90 inhibitor. The drug product, retaspimycin hydrochloride, is being evaluated in three disease-focused clinical trials. For more information on our clinical trials, please view the Clinical Trials page.
IPI-926 is our lead orally administered small molecule inhibitor of the Hedgehog signaling pathway. The Hedgehog pathway is believed to play a central role in allowing the proliferation and survival of certain cancer-causing cells and is implicated in many of the most deadly cancers. We believe that IPI-926 has the potential to be a best-in-class systemic inhibitor of the Hedgehog pathway, actively interfering with its deleterious effects.
